Presentation of the project results during the national seminar “From Generation Z to Generation Europass – a successful path from vocational training to the labor market”

The national seminar was organised by the National agency of Erasmus+ in Bulgaria and the Bulgarian National VET team. It was focused on students and their teachers from vocational high schools in the region within the framework of the “European Year of Skills – 2023”.

In the program of the seminar, achievements of students from vocational high schools were demonstrated from: PGEE – Bansko, who demonstrated the development of artificial intelligence ; PGTLP “Gotse Delchev” – city of Blagoevgrad, who presented achievements in “Catering” and “Organization of tourism and free time” specialties and ZPG “Kliment Timiryazev”, town of Sandanski, who presented activities from the specialty “Specialist of thermal-spa activities”.

The consortium was represented by Mrs. Penka Nikolova from 94 SU “Dimitar Strashimirov” – coordinator of the project and Mr. Andrean Lazarov (moderator of the event and CEO of the Bulgarian Inclusion Support Team) demonstrated tips and good practices in creating the professional resume (through the Europass tools) and motivation letter for a successful career. They conducted practical sessions based on VISAGE4JOBS training toolkit (www.visage4jobs.eu) . In the framework of the workshop, Mrs. Nikolova consulted teachers about common mistakes and advice in career development and preparation for the labor market, as well as provided guidelines for overcoming them with a view to easier access to the labor market in Bulgaria.
